xref: /aosp_15_r20/development/samples/AconfigDemo/aconfig_demo_flags.aconfig (revision 90c8c64db3049935a07c6143d7fd006e26f8ecca)
1*90c8c64dSAndroid Build Coastguard Workerpackage: "com.example.android.aconfig.demo.flags"
2*90c8c64dSAndroid Build Coastguard Workercontainer: "system"
3*90c8c64dSAndroid Build Coastguard Worker
4*90c8c64dSAndroid Build Coastguard Workerflag {
5*90c8c64dSAndroid Build Coastguard Worker  name: "append_injected_content"
6*90c8c64dSAndroid Build Coastguard Worker  namespace: "aconfig_demo_ns"
7*90c8c64dSAndroid Build Coastguard Worker  description: "This flag controls injected content"
8*90c8c64dSAndroid Build Coastguard Worker  bug: "287644619"
9*90c8c64dSAndroid Build Coastguard Worker}
10*90c8c64dSAndroid Build Coastguard Worker
11*90c8c64dSAndroid Build Coastguard Workerflag {
12*90c8c64dSAndroid Build Coastguard Worker  name: "append_static_content"
13*90c8c64dSAndroid Build Coastguard Worker  namespace: "aconfig_demo_ns"
14*90c8c64dSAndroid Build Coastguard Worker  description: "This flag controls static content"
15*90c8c64dSAndroid Build Coastguard Worker  bug: "287644619"
16*90c8c64dSAndroid Build Coastguard Worker}
17*90c8c64dSAndroid Build Coastguard Worker
18*90c8c64dSAndroid Build Coastguard Workerflag {
19*90c8c64dSAndroid Build Coastguard Worker  name: "awesome_flag_1"
20*90c8c64dSAndroid Build Coastguard Worker  namespace: "test"
21*90c8c64dSAndroid Build Coastguard Worker  description: "A very awesome flag for testing purposes."
22*90c8c64dSAndroid Build Coastguard Worker  bug: "287644619"
23*90c8c64dSAndroid Build Coastguard Worker}
24*90c8c64dSAndroid Build Coastguard Worker
25*90c8c64dSAndroid Build Coastguard Workerflag {
26*90c8c64dSAndroid Build Coastguard Worker  name: "awesome_flag_2"
27*90c8c64dSAndroid Build Coastguard Worker  namespace: "test"
28*90c8c64dSAndroid Build Coastguard Worker  description: "Another awesome flag for testing purposes."
29*90c8c64dSAndroid Build Coastguard Worker  bug: "287644619"
30*90c8c64dSAndroid Build Coastguard Worker}
31*90c8c64dSAndroid Build Coastguard Worker
32*90c8c64dSAndroid Build Coastguard Workerflag {
33*90c8c64dSAndroid Build Coastguard Worker    name: "fifth_flag"
34*90c8c64dSAndroid Build Coastguard Worker    namespace: "configuration"
35*90c8c64dSAndroid Build Coastguard Worker    description: "The fifth flag, added right after the first three flags."
36*90c8c64dSAndroid Build Coastguard Worker    bug: "287644619"
37*90c8c64dSAndroid Build Coastguard Worker}
38*90c8c64dSAndroid Build Coastguard Worker
39*90c8c64dSAndroid Build Coastguard Workerflag {
40*90c8c64dSAndroid Build Coastguard Worker  name: "third_flag"
41*90c8c64dSAndroid Build Coastguard Worker  namespace: "configuration"
42*90c8c64dSAndroid Build Coastguard Worker  description: "This flag controls static content"
43*90c8c64dSAndroid Build Coastguard Worker  bug: "287644619"
44*90c8c64dSAndroid Build Coastguard Worker}
45*90c8c64dSAndroid Build Coastguard Worker
46*90c8c64dSAndroid Build Coastguard Workerflag {
47*90c8c64dSAndroid Build Coastguard Worker  name: "read_only_flag"
48*90c8c64dSAndroid Build Coastguard Worker  namespace: "core_experiments_team_internal"
49*90c8c64dSAndroid Build Coastguard Worker  description: "A read only flag for demo"
50*90c8c64dSAndroid Build Coastguard Worker  bug: "298754733"
51*90c8c64dSAndroid Build Coastguard Worker  is_fixed_read_only: true
52*90c8c64dSAndroid Build Coastguard Worker}
53*90c8c64dSAndroid Build Coastguard Worker
54*90c8c64dSAndroid Build Coastguard Workerflag {
55*90c8c64dSAndroid Build Coastguard Worker  name: "support_bugfix_templates_demo_flag"
56*90c8c64dSAndroid Build Coastguard Worker  namespace: "core_experiments_team_internal"
57*90c8c64dSAndroid Build Coastguard Worker  description: "A server-side flag for bugfix workflow demo"
58*90c8c64dSAndroid Build Coastguard Worker  bug: "311226181"
59*90c8c64dSAndroid Build Coastguard Worker  metadata {
60*90c8c64dSAndroid Build Coastguard Worker    purpose: PURPOSE_BUGFIX
61*90c8c64dSAndroid Build Coastguard Worker  }
62*90c8c64dSAndroid Build Coastguard Worker}
63*90c8c64dSAndroid Build Coastguard Worker
64*90c8c64dSAndroid Build Coastguard Workerflag {
65*90c8c64dSAndroid Build Coastguard Worker  name: "support_bugfix_templates_demo_flag_fixed_read_only"
66*90c8c64dSAndroid Build Coastguard Worker  namespace: "core_experiments_team_internal"
67*90c8c64dSAndroid Build Coastguard Worker  description: "A fixed-read-only flag for bugfix workflow demo"
68*90c8c64dSAndroid Build Coastguard Worker  bug: "311226181"
69*90c8c64dSAndroid Build Coastguard Worker  is_fixed_read_only: true
70*90c8c64dSAndroid Build Coastguard Worker  metadata {
71*90c8c64dSAndroid Build Coastguard Worker    purpose: PURPOSE_BUGFIX
72*90c8c64dSAndroid Build Coastguard Worker  }
73*90c8c64dSAndroid Build Coastguard Worker}
74*90c8c64dSAndroid Build Coastguard Worker
75*90c8c64dSAndroid Build Coastguard Workerflag {
76*90c8c64dSAndroid Build Coastguard Worker  name: "support_wear_bugfix_templates_demo_flag"
77*90c8c64dSAndroid Build Coastguard Worker  namespace: "wear_sysui"
78*90c8c64dSAndroid Build Coastguard Worker  description: "A server-side flag for wear bugfix workflow demo"
79*90c8c64dSAndroid Build Coastguard Worker  bug: "311226181"
80*90c8c64dSAndroid Build Coastguard Worker  metadata {
81*90c8c64dSAndroid Build Coastguard Worker    purpose: PURPOSE_BUGFIX
82*90c8c64dSAndroid Build Coastguard Worker  }
83*90c8c64dSAndroid Build Coastguard Worker}
84*90c8c64dSAndroid Build Coastguard Worker
85*90c8c64dSAndroid Build Coastguard Workerflag {
86*90c8c64dSAndroid Build Coastguard Worker  name: "support_wear_bugfix_templates_demo_flag_fixed_read_only"
87*90c8c64dSAndroid Build Coastguard Worker  namespace: "wear_sysui"
88*90c8c64dSAndroid Build Coastguard Worker  description: "A fixed-read-only flag for wear bugfix workflow demo"
89*90c8c64dSAndroid Build Coastguard Worker  bug: "311226181"
90*90c8c64dSAndroid Build Coastguard Worker  is_fixed_read_only: true
91*90c8c64dSAndroid Build Coastguard Worker  metadata {
92*90c8c64dSAndroid Build Coastguard Worker    purpose: PURPOSE_BUGFIX
93*90c8c64dSAndroid Build Coastguard Worker  }
94*90c8c64dSAndroid Build Coastguard Worker}
95*90c8c64dSAndroid Build Coastguard Worker
96*90c8c64dSAndroid Build Coastguard Workerflag {
97*90c8c64dSAndroid Build Coastguard Worker  name: "test_mendel_gantry_disintegration"
98*90c8c64dSAndroid Build Coastguard Worker  namespace: "gantry"
99*90c8c64dSAndroid Build Coastguard Worker  description: "A regular server-side flag moving on new path to gantry"
100*90c8c64dSAndroid Build Coastguard Worker  bug: "336346880"
101*90c8c64dSAndroid Build Coastguard Worker  is_fixed_read_only: false
102*90c8c64dSAndroid Build Coastguard Worker}
103*90c8c64dSAndroid Build Coastguard Worker
104*90c8c64dSAndroid Build Coastguard Workerflag {
105*90c8c64dSAndroid Build Coastguard Worker  name: "test_mendel_gantry_disintegration_again"
106*90c8c64dSAndroid Build Coastguard Worker  namespace: "core_experiments_team_internal"
107*90c8c64dSAndroid Build Coastguard Worker  description: "A regular server-side flag moving on new path to gantry"
108*90c8c64dSAndroid Build Coastguard Worker  bug: "336346880"
109*90c8c64dSAndroid Build Coastguard Worker  is_fixed_read_only: false
110*90c8c64dSAndroid Build Coastguard Worker}
111*90c8c64dSAndroid Build Coastguard Worker
112*90c8c64dSAndroid Build Coastguard Workerflag {
113*90c8c64dSAndroid Build Coastguard Worker  name: "yet_another_test_flag"
114*90c8c64dSAndroid Build Coastguard Worker  namespace: "gantry"
115*90c8c64dSAndroid Build Coastguard Worker  description: "Another regular server-side flag moving on new path to gantry"
116*90c8c64dSAndroid Build Coastguard Worker  bug: "336346880"
117*90c8c64dSAndroid Build Coastguard Worker  is_fixed_read_only: false
118*90c8c64dSAndroid Build Coastguard Worker}
119*90c8c64dSAndroid Build Coastguard Worker
120*90c8c64dSAndroid Build Coastguard Workerflag {
121*90c8c64dSAndroid Build Coastguard Worker  name: "yet_another_mendel_gantry_disintegration_flag"
122*90c8c64dSAndroid Build Coastguard Worker  namespace: "core_experiments_team_internal"
123*90c8c64dSAndroid Build Coastguard Worker  description: "Another regular server-side flag moving on new path to gantry"
124*90c8c64dSAndroid Build Coastguard Worker  bug: "336346880"
125*90c8c64dSAndroid Build Coastguard Worker  is_fixed_read_only: false
126*90c8c64dSAndroid Build Coastguard Worker}
127*90c8c64dSAndroid Build Coastguard Worker
128*90c8c64dSAndroid Build Coastguard Workerflag {
129*90c8c64dSAndroid Build Coastguard Worker  name: "yet_another_test_bugfix_flag"
130*90c8c64dSAndroid Build Coastguard Worker  namespace: "gantry"
131*90c8c64dSAndroid Build Coastguard Worker  description: "Another regular server-side flag moving on new path to gantry"
132*90c8c64dSAndroid Build Coastguard Worker  bug: "336346880"
133*90c8c64dSAndroid Build Coastguard Worker  is_fixed_read_only: false
134*90c8c64dSAndroid Build Coastguard Worker  metadata {
135*90c8c64dSAndroid Build Coastguard Worker    purpose: PURPOSE_BUGFIX
136*90c8c64dSAndroid Build Coastguard Worker  }
137*90c8c64dSAndroid Build Coastguard Worker}
138*90c8c64dSAndroid Build Coastguard Worker
139*90c8c64dSAndroid Build Coastguard Workerflag {
140*90c8c64dSAndroid Build Coastguard Worker  name: "yet_another_mendel_gantry_disintegration_bugfix_flag"
141*90c8c64dSAndroid Build Coastguard Worker  namespace: "core_experiments_team_internal"
142*90c8c64dSAndroid Build Coastguard Worker  description: "Another regular server-side flag moving on new path to gantry"
143*90c8c64dSAndroid Build Coastguard Worker  bug: "336346880"
144*90c8c64dSAndroid Build Coastguard Worker  is_fixed_read_only: false
145*90c8c64dSAndroid Build Coastguard Worker  metadata {
146*90c8c64dSAndroid Build Coastguard Worker    purpose: PURPOSE_BUGFIX
147*90c8c64dSAndroid Build Coastguard Worker  }
148*90c8c64dSAndroid Build Coastguard Worker}
149*90c8c64dSAndroid Build Coastguard Workerflag {
150*90c8c64dSAndroid Build Coastguard Worker    name: "pc_test_1"
151*90c8c64dSAndroid Build Coastguard Worker    namespace: "core_experiments_team_internal"
152*90c8c64dSAndroid Build Coastguard Worker    description: "A test flag to verify saturation improvements"
153*90c8c64dSAndroid Build Coastguard Worker    bug: "336778457"
154*90c8c64dSAndroid Build Coastguard Worker    is_fixed_read_only: false
155*90c8c64dSAndroid Build Coastguard Worker}
156*90c8c64dSAndroid Build Coastguard Workerflag {
157*90c8c64dSAndroid Build Coastguard Worker    name: "pc_test_2"
158*90c8c64dSAndroid Build Coastguard Worker    namespace: "core_experiments_team_internal"
159*90c8c64dSAndroid Build Coastguard Worker    description: "A test flag to verify saturation improvements"
160*90c8c64dSAndroid Build Coastguard Worker    bug: "336778457"
161*90c8c64dSAndroid Build Coastguard Worker    is_fixed_read_only: false
162*90c8c64dSAndroid Build Coastguard Worker}
163*90c8c64dSAndroid Build Coastguard Workerflag {
164*90c8c64dSAndroid Build Coastguard Worker    name: "pc_test_3"
165*90c8c64dSAndroid Build Coastguard Worker    namespace: "core_experiments_team_internal"
166*90c8c64dSAndroid Build Coastguard Worker    description: "A test flag to verify saturation improvements"
167*90c8c64dSAndroid Build Coastguard Worker    bug: "336778457"
168*90c8c64dSAndroid Build Coastguard Worker    is_fixed_read_only: false
169*90c8c64dSAndroid Build Coastguard Worker}
170*90c8c64dSAndroid Build Coastguard Workerflag {
171*90c8c64dSAndroid Build Coastguard Worker    name: "pc_test_4"
172*90c8c64dSAndroid Build Coastguard Worker    namespace: "core_experiments_team_internal"
173*90c8c64dSAndroid Build Coastguard Worker    description: "A test flag to verify saturation improvements"
174*90c8c64dSAndroid Build Coastguard Worker    bug: "336778457"
175*90c8c64dSAndroid Build Coastguard Worker    is_fixed_read_only: false
176*90c8c64dSAndroid Build Coastguard Worker}
177*90c8c64dSAndroid Build Coastguard Workerflag {
178*90c8c64dSAndroid Build Coastguard Worker    name: "pc_test_5"
179*90c8c64dSAndroid Build Coastguard Worker    namespace: "core_experiments_team_internal"
180*90c8c64dSAndroid Build Coastguard Worker    description: "A test flag to verify saturation improvements"
181*90c8c64dSAndroid Build Coastguard Worker    bug: "336778457"
182*90c8c64dSAndroid Build Coastguard Worker    is_fixed_read_only: false
183*90c8c64dSAndroid Build Coastguard Worker}
184*90c8c64dSAndroid Build Coastguard Workerflag {
185*90c8c64dSAndroid Build Coastguard Worker    name: "pc_test_6"
186*90c8c64dSAndroid Build Coastguard Worker    namespace: "core_experiments_team_internal"
187*90c8c64dSAndroid Build Coastguard Worker    description: "A test flag to verify saturation improvements"
188*90c8c64dSAndroid Build Coastguard Worker    bug: "336778457"
189*90c8c64dSAndroid Build Coastguard Worker    is_fixed_read_only: false
190*90c8c64dSAndroid Build Coastguard Worker}
191*90c8c64dSAndroid Build Coastguard Workerflag {
192*90c8c64dSAndroid Build Coastguard Worker    name: "pc_test_7"
193*90c8c64dSAndroid Build Coastguard Worker    namespace: "core_experiments_team_internal"
194*90c8c64dSAndroid Build Coastguard Worker    description: "A test flag to verify saturation improvements"
195*90c8c64dSAndroid Build Coastguard Worker    bug: "336778457"
196*90c8c64dSAndroid Build Coastguard Worker    is_fixed_read_only: false
197*90c8c64dSAndroid Build Coastguard Worker}
198*90c8c64dSAndroid Build Coastguard Workerflag {
199*90c8c64dSAndroid Build Coastguard Worker    name: "one_stage_rollback_test_flag"
200*90c8c64dSAndroid Build Coastguard Worker    namespace: "gantry"
201*90c8c64dSAndroid Build Coastguard Worker    description: "A test flag to verify one stage rollback"
202*90c8c64dSAndroid Build Coastguard Worker    bug: "303703498"
203*90c8c64dSAndroid Build Coastguard Worker    is_fixed_read_only: false
204*90c8c64dSAndroid Build Coastguard Worker}